Abstract

Abstract: The paper will outline the basic SWOT and PEST analysis features of the Bayer-AG company from Leverkusen. In this paper, we will present the strengths and opportunities, as well as the weaknesses and threats of the mentioned company. The Bayer AG demonstrates its strength through its strong business relationship and focus on research and development for product improvement. All human resources and financial flow management are well utilized. The paper also deals with the political and technological environment in which the company is located and how it affects the business . Keywords: Bayer AG, SWOT, PEST analysis.
